Want to know why the Rockets lost? Look beyond simplistic explanations.

The Houston Rockets’ demoralizing loss to the Los Angeles Lakers has sparked the latest round of the “this style doesn’t work” conversation, which crops up anytime a team tries something different and fails to win a championship.

For the most part, these discussions are reductive and silly. They came in droves when Mike D’Antoni’s “Seven Seconds or Less” Phoenix Suns lost, as if it was his offensive system that caused key players to leave the bench during an altercation and get slapped with automatic suspensions.

As it turned out, that “style” worked just fine — its major concepts were adopted by teams that ended up winning championships, including the San Antonio Spurs, Golden State Warriors and Dallas Mavericks.
